Yellow Journalism -Exaggerated stories describing conditions for Cubans Americans sympathize with Cubans Cuban Revolution -Cubans rebel against Spanish rule -Spanish General Weyler sent to break up rebellion. Placed rebels in concentration camps -Jose Marti Destruction of plantations Americans sympathize with Cubans Spanish-American War April-Aug 1898 De Lome Letter Spanish Minister to the U.S- Enrique Dupuy de Lome writes a letter calling McKinley weak -Americans angry Monroe Doctrine -Limit European influence in Latin America Sinking of USS Maine American ship sent to Cuba to protect Americans and property. Explodes off the coast of Havana Feb 15th 1898. Explosion a mystery! Expansionist Pressure Wanted Spanish spoils: Cuba Puerto Rico Philippines Guam
